This technology involves using two panes of glass separated by a layer of air or gas, providing a range of advantages over traditional single-pane doors. What are Double Glazed Doors? What are Double Glazed Doors? Double glazed doors consist of two glass panes separated by a spacer bar and sealed to create a gap between them. This gap is typically filled with air or an inert gas like argon. The design of double glazed doors helps to improve insulation and reduce heat transfer, making them more energy-efficient compared to single-pane doors. Benefits of Double Glazed Doors Benefits of Double Glazed Doors 1.Improved Insulation: One of the primary benefits of double glazed doors is their superior insulation properties. The layer of air or gas between the glass panes acts as an effective thermal barrier, reducing heat loss during winter and heat gain during summer. This helps to maintain a comfortable indoor temperature year-round and reduces the need for heating and cooling, resulting in lower energy bills. 2.Noise Reduction: Double glazed doors significantly reduce outside noise, making them ideal for homes in noisy urban areas or near busy roads. The two glass panes and the insulating layer between them absorb and dampen sound waves, creating a quieter indoor environment. This can improve overall comfort and quality of life for occupants. 3.Enhanced Security: Double glazed doors offer improved security compared to single-pane doors. The multiple layers of glass and the reinforced frame make it more difficult for intruders to break through, providing an additional layer of protection for your home and family. This increased security can provide peace of mind and may even reduce insurance premiums. 4.Reduced Condensation: Condensation on windows and doors can be a problem, leading to mold and mildew growth. Double glazed doors reduce condensation because the inner glass remains warmer, reducing the
temperature difference between the glass and the room air. This helps to maintain a drier and healthier indoor environment. 5.UV Protection: Double glazed doors provide some protection against UV rays. The two glass panes can help reduce the amount of UV light entering your home, which can fade furniture, carpets, and other interior furnishings over time. This UV protection can help preserve the appearance and longevity of your belongings. Types of Double Glazed Doors Types of Double Glazed Doors Double glazed doors are available in various styles and materials to suit different architectural styles and preferences: UPVC Double Glazed Doors: UPVC (Unplasticized Polyvinyl Chloride) frames are durable, low-maintenance, and energy-efficient. UPVC doors are available in a variety of colors and finishes, making them a popular choice for homeowners. Aluminum Double Glazed Doors: Aluminum frames are strong, lightweight, and can be powder-coated in a range of colors. They offer excellent thermal performance and are suitable for larger door openings.
Timber Double Glazed Doors: Timber frames provide a classic, natural look and excellent insulation properties. Timber doors are versatile and can be painted or stained to match the interior or exterior of your home. Installation and Maintenance Installation and Maintenance Proper installation is crucial for maximizing the benefits of double glazed doors. It's essential to choose a reputable supplier and installer who can ensure a tight seal and proper alignment of the door. A professional installer will also ensure that the frame and hinges are correctly adjusted to prevent any air leakage or drafts. Regular maintenance is important to keep your double glazed doors in optimal condition: Cleaning: Regularly clean the glass panes with a mild detergent and water solution to remove dirt and grime. Avoid using abrasive cleaners or materials that could scratch the glass. Lubrication: Lubricate hinges, locks, and other moving parts with a silicone- based lubricant to ensure smooth operation. Check and tighten any screws or bolts as needed. Seals and Gaskets: Inspect the seals and gaskets around the door frame regularly for signs of wear or damage. Replace any worn seals to maintain the door's insulation properties.
